Finding the Best Printer with Cheap Ink: Your Smart Shopping Guide
Are you tired of watching your printer ink costs climb higher than your printing volume? You’re not alone! Many people want a printer that works well without draining their wallets on ink cartridges. This guide will help you find that perfect printer.
Why is Ink Cost So Important?
Ink is a recurring cost. Even if a printer seems cheap at first, the ink can make it expensive over time. We want to help you find a printer that saves you money in the long run.
Key Features to Look For
When you shop for a printer, keep these important features in mind.
- Ink Tank System: Instead of small cartridges, these printers have refillable tanks. You buy ink in bottles, which is much cheaper per page.
- Print Speed: How fast does the printer print pages? If you print a lot, a faster printer saves you time.
- Print Quality: Does it print sharp text and bright colors? This is important for documents and photos.
- Connectivity Options: Can you connect wirelessly from your phone or computer? Wi-Fi and mobile printing are very handy.
- All-in-One Capabilities: Do you need to scan and copy too? Many printers do more than just print.
- Paper Handling: How much paper can it hold? Does it print on different types of paper?
Important Materials and Technology
The technology inside the printer affects its performance and cost.
- Ink Type: Most ink tank printers use dye-based or pigment-based ink. Pigment ink is usually better for documents because it’s more water-resistant and lasts longer. Dye ink often gives brighter colors for photos.
- Printhead Technology: The printhead puts the ink on the paper. Different technologies offer different speeds and quality. Modern printheads are very efficient.
Factors That Affect Printer and Ink Quality
Some things make a printer and its ink perform better or worse.
What Makes Printer Quality Better:
- High Resolution (DPI): Higher DPI means sharper images and text.
- Good Ink Formulation: High-quality ink flows well and doesn’t clog the printheads.
- Durable Build: A well-made printer lasts longer.
- Easy Ink Refills: Simple refill systems prevent spills and frustration.
What Makes Printer Quality Worse:
- Low-Quality Ink: This can lead to faded prints, clogged heads, and poor color.
- Cheaply Made Components: These can break easily.
- Complex Ink Systems: Some systems are hard to refill.
- Frequent Clogging: If the printheads clog often, you waste ink and time.

Q: What does “cheapest ink” really mean?
A: It means the cost per page printed is very low. Ink tank printers usually offer the cheapest ink.
Q: Are ink tank printers better than cartridge printers?
A: For saving money on ink, yes. Ink tank printers are much cheaper to refill.
Q: Will the ink quality be bad if it’s cheap?
A: Not necessarily. Good ink tank printers use quality ink that is just sold in larger, cheaper bottles.
Q: How do I know if a printer has good print quality?
A: Look for high DPI (dots per inch) and read reviews that talk about sharp text and vibrant colors.
Q: Can I use third-party ink in these printers?
A: Some ink tank printers work with compatible ink. Always check the printer’s manual or manufacturer’s website.
Q: How often do I need to refill the ink tanks?
A: It depends on how much you print. Some tanks can print thousands of pages before needing a refill.
Q: What is DPI?
A: DPI stands for Dots Per Inch. It tells you how many ink dots the printer can put in one inch. More dots mean a clearer picture.
Q: Do all ink tank printers print photos well?
A: Not all. Some are better for documents, while others are designed for great photo prints. Check the printer’s specs for photo quality.
Q: Is setting up an ink tank printer difficult?
A: Most ink tank printers are designed to be easy to set up. Filling the tanks is usually straightforward.
Q: What should I do if my printer’s ink runs out quickly?
A: Check your print settings. Printing in “draft” mode uses less ink. Also, make sure you are not printing excessively large files.
